William Stirk (30), farmer, together with his brother Joseph Stirk (18), were members of Jonathan Wainwright's Party of 24 Settlers on the John.
Party originated from Yorkshire, England.
Departed Liverpool, 13 January 1820. Arrived Table Bay, Cape Town on 19 April 1820. Final Port - Algoa Bay, Port Elizabeth May 1820.
Area Allocated to the Party : Harewood, Lynedoch River.
